Yale scientists may have found how Parkinson's disease spreads through the brain

Yale researchers have identified a two-protein complex that may enable Parkinson's-linked proteins to spread between neurons and trigger brain damage.

What happened

Yale scientists are investigating the mechanism by which a protein linked to Parkinson's disease spreads from cell to cell. The research has identified a specific two-protein complex that appears to facilitate the entry of these proteins into neurons, potentially leading to cellular damage.

Coverage from ScienceDaily, Newsweek, and ScienceBlog.com emphasizes the discovery of this transport mechanism. The Van Andel Institute has further detailed these pathways through a Q&A with Postdoctoral Fellow Dr.

Naman Vatsa, describing the process as a form of protein 'peer pressure.' Future focus remains on the potential to slow the spread of the disease based on these findings, as noted in reports by Newsweek.
